Working with aluminium in a workshop often demands precise cuts, and a miter saw is frequently the ideal instrument for the task . However, machining aluminium presents unique challenges compared to timber . This explanation covers crucial considerations, including blade selection—opt for a high-tooth count blade designed for non-ferrous stock—and speed control, which should be lowered to minimize friction and edge creation. Remember to always use appropriate protective equipment, like eye protection and a dust respirator, when operating a angle saw on aluminum. Proper method will produce clean, accurate, and precise sections.

Optimizing Miter Saw Performance for Aluminium Cuts
Successfully producing clean, precise divisions in aluminum with a miter saw demands particular adjustments and methods . Reducing the blade’s RPM is essential to avoid melting and ensure a smoother, less forceful shearing action. Utilizing a fine-toothed blade – ideally one made specifically for non-ferrous materials – will also significantly enhance the standard of your work . Finally, remember to dampen the blade and material as the process to minimize heat buildup and aid a cleaner finish.
